Vyacheslav Egorov dcac60b672 [vm/aot] Fix BoxInt64 in deferred units
When generating code for deferred units compiler
can't emit PC relative call to the shared Mint allocation
stub. This causes compiler to emit an indirect call
through a Code object. Such calls clobber CODE_REG
which is actually an allocatable register.

Fix this by using non-allocatable register instead of
CODE_REG when generating indirect calls through
Code object in AOT mode. Callees don't expect
anything useful in CODE_REG anyway because AOT
calling convetion does not use it.

Alexander Markov 87810072db [vm] Account for changes in the implicit getters due to load guards
Hot reload may mark certain fields as 'needs_load_guard', meaning
types of their values should be checked on access, in the implicit
getters.

Unoptimized code for implicit getters of such fields should be
forcefully recompiled during hot reload in order to update their
code. This ensures that optimized code in future can deoptimize
into the updated unoptimized code of implicit getters.

Vyacheslav Egorov 24a30defcc [vm] Ensure liveness of typed data containing Kernel binary
When handling hot reload via library tag handler's Kernel tag
VM must guarantee that external typed data it receives from the
embedder stays alive for as long as VM has any structures
referencing this kernel binary. This is achieved by attaching
original typed data to KernelProgramInfo objects containing
the views into it.

Unfortunately kernel::Reader APIs were somewhat unsafe: allowing
to construct reader object from Program's raw buffer and forget to
set the link betwen the reader and original typed data.

This created a situation where reloading using a multicomponent
Kernel binary would result in KernelProgramInfo objects without
link to the original typed data, which in turn leads to premature
finalization of external typed data and subsequent crashes
when trying to use delete kernel binary.

This CL reworks kernel::Reader API (by introducing kernel::ProgramBinary
wrapper) to make it safer and make sure that connection is preserved.

Alexander Aprelev 9c4a322b08 Reland "[vm/isolates] Introduce fast isolate spawn in AOT."
This reverts commit 922ea3e9b6 in patchset 1, fix for assertion triggered in https://ci.chromium.org/b/8883214567628884960 in patchset 2, fix for deadlock around symbols table mutex in patchset 4.

Original commit description:

Speed up is achieved by sharing most of the dart code, object store
and class table between isolates in single isolate group. So
instead of bootstrapping isolate from the snapshot, isolate is
initialized by setting pointers to existing data structures already
set up for first isolate, and only few isolate-specific structures (moved
to newly introducted isolate_object_store) are created.

To allow for safe cross-isolate switchable call site, type test cache
mutations additional synchronization via RunWithStoppedMutators(that
relies on safepoints) was added.
Besides switchable call sites, no other mutation to the dart code is
done in AOT, which allows such sharing.
